Activity itinerary

Grabouw (Pass by)
A town located about 65 km from Cape Town in the Western Cape Province. This town is along the N2 motorway and is the commercial centre of Elgin Valley. The original inhabitants of the area are the Khoikhoi pastoralists and the San Hunter gatherers.
Elgin Valley Honey (Pass by)
This is a huge lush area of land surrounded by mountains in the Overberg region of the Western Cape province. This area is 70 km southeast of Cape Town, just beyond the Hottentots-Holland Mountains. This region is one of the more intensively farmed districts which produces 60% of the national apple crop. A recent economic shift means Elgin is also becoming one of the country's most notable and successful wine regions. This is because Elgin has the coolest climate of any region in South Africa. Hence Elgin wines and tourism have consequently become significant parts of the valley's economy.
Caledon (Pass by)
This is another town in the Overberg region in the Western Cape South Africa at least 100 km along the N2 motorway. Located next to the mineral-rich hot springs. This is mainly an agricultural region whose activities involve grain production with a certain amount of stock farming. The town is locally known for the Caledon Spa and Casino as well as its rolling hills and yellow canola fields.
Bredasdorp (Pass by)
This is a very historic town in the Overberg region of the Western Cape province in South Africa. It is also the main economic and service hub, lying 160 km from Cape Town and only 35 km from Cape Agulhas. The main attraction here include the Heuningberg Nature Reserve, many historical churches, art galleries and art and craft shops. Bredasdorp is also home to the Shipwreck Museum which details stories of 150 wrecks along the Agulhas Reef This is the only museum of its kind in the southern hemisphere. The farming community are known to produce merino sheep in large numbers.
Cape Agulhas - Southernmost Tip of Africa
  • 1h
This is the geographical southern tip of Africa and is a popular landmark. Explore this popular location which was discovered by Portuguese sailors in the year 1500 and is the beginning of the dividing line between the Atlantic and Indian Oceans. This location has a spectacular coastline, which is gradually curving with rocky and sand beaches. Take a walk on the shallow waters and enjoy the soft granular sand under your feet. This is considered to be the richest fishing region in the southern hemisphere. Look out for a survey marker and a new icon depicting the African continent located at the southernmost tip of Africa. Enjoy the warm Mediterranean climate which is consistently mild with no temperature and rainfall extremes.
Cape Agulhas Lighthouse
  • 10m
  • Admission ticket not included
This historic lighthouse is situated at Cape Agulhas, the southernmost tip of Africa. Being the second oldest still operating it was the third oldest to be built. Visit this lighthouse located on the southern edge of the village of L'Agulhas in the Agulhas National Park. It is an outstanding structure with a round tower, 27 metres high and painted red with a white band. There is also a museum attached to it which provides a lot of interesting information and history of this iconic place.
